This is an excellent app overall, and works with many different grammar books. However, it doesn’t save your progress when going through lists, which is extremely frustrating! Hopefully the developer will address this. *** The developer let me know that you can use the filter to exclude certain words after getting them correct a user-defined number of times. In this way you can keep from having to do the same words over again if you can’t finish your current session. This works I suppose!
As another reviewer has said, I would send these concerns to the developer if there was a place for bug reporting, so call that a meta-bug. Another meta-bug is that there is no version information in the app so I have no way of knowing if I have the latest version, and there is no “update” feature in the app or on this page. How do we update? Bugs: there are parse errors, e.g., οιδασιν is listed as a perfect. More bothersome is that random presentations of more than one correct parsing accept only one of the solutions (this often comes up with AccSingMasc and Nom/AccPluralNeuter, e.g.). Answering the other one is marked “wrong.” Then when the word comes round again, it might be looking for the other solution. Or it might not, and the right solution must be guessed or it keeps coming back as a missed question. The case of multiple correct answers needs to be handled better. I also shut down for a while when I was being presented with questions that were outside the scope of my reading. I think participles might have popped up before I got there in my text. I am back to the app now, and bothering to write this review, because of the very useful feature of spanning verbal moods, e.g., indicative and participles. That is a tough skill for me, and I really appreciate ParseGreek’s help in learning it. I haven’t focused on the many great qualities of this app, but the drawbacks mentioned above have been pretty close to deal breakers for me.
